This is the basic movement that is done in Dead or Alive. The environment is highly important to involve with your game-play in combination with the movement (Free Stepping).

EXTRA DAMAGE GAINED FORM THE ENVIRONMENT!

Non-explosive walls add 10 extra points of damage to the attacks and throws that wall splat your opponent.

Explosive walls add 15 points of damage to attacks and throws that wall splat your opponent.

When your opponent does not fully hit the wall and splat, but bounce off the it. The damage for both non-explosive and explosive walls is reduced to 5 (for non-explosive) and 10 (for explosive) points of damage.

Explosive floors add 5 points of damage to attacks that slam your opponent to the ground. An explosive floor adds 10 points of damage to particular throws that slam your opponent to the ground. Not all throws will get the bonus of 10 points of damage. The damage varies for different throws that ground slam your opponent.

Break-away floors will 10 points of damage to the attacks and throws that send your opponent through them.
